About Trellis

Trellis builds and deploys computer-use AI agents that get patients access to life-saving medicine. Our agents process billions of dollars worth of therapies a year , automating document intake, prior authorizations, and appeals at scale — classifying medical referrals, understanding chart notes, and automating contract and reimbursement search to give patients accurate coverage determinations and cost responsibility. The result is streamlined operations and faster care for patients in all fifty states.

We're a spinout from the Stanford AI Lab, backed by leading investors including Y Combinator, General Catalyst, and Telesoft Partners, alongside executives at Google and Salesforce.

The Role

We're hiring a Windows Systems Engineer to own the Windows Server and Remote Desktop Services (RDS) infrastructure that powers our fleet of computer-use agents. This is a deeply hands-on systems engineering role: you'll keep the session hosts, service accounts, scheduled tasks, and underlying Windows environments stable, performant, and recoverable — at a scale where downtime has real consequences.

The Scale

The infrastructure you'll own operates at serious scale and directly supports patient care:

Thousands of computer-use agents running concurrently, 24/7

20M+ prescriptions processed every year

400 clinics live across all 50 states

$15B+ in medications dispensed flowing through the systems you keep running

When a session host hangs or an agent stalls, it isn't an abstract SLA breach — it's a clinic waiting on a prescription. Reliability here is the job.

Key Responsibilities

Windows Server Operations

Administer and maintain a fleet of Windows Server hosts: patching, reboots, and upgrades with minimal disruption

Diagnose and remediate runaway processes, memory leaks, high CPU, and zombie sessions on live hosts

Manage scheduled tasks for agent startup, watchdogs, and automated recovery

Configure networking, service wrappers, and per-agent tunneling

Own the identity and access plumbing — service accounts, permissions, and Group Policy / Active Directory where it touches the fleet

RDS & Session Management

Administer RDS Session Hosts: session limits, autologon, persistence, and recovery of dropped or frozen sessions

Manage RDS licensing (CALs, grace periods) and troubleshoot licensing-related failures

Handle loopback/local RDP architectures and use session shadowing to debug live agents

Fleet Provisioning, Scaling & Lifecycle

Provision and decommission agents on demand, including service accounts, sessions, and per-agent environments

Manage capacity, rebalance load across hosts, and scale session-host capacity up or down to match demand

Roll out upgrades safely with staged/canary rollouts and clear rollback plans

Maintain golden images so hosts and agents come up consistently and predictably
